A queue of trucks on the South African side of the border is reportedly stretching up to 10kms from the border. and they are reportedly being caused by COVID-19 scrutiny by both countries. We are working with the port health officials to see an improved situation. A trucking agent who spoke to the publication also said the queues were unbearable as some truckers were spending 3 days in the queue: > Trucks are taking long to get to customs and excise points for both physical examinations either for imports or exportsIf a trucker leaves the queue, getting back into the line takes hours with the trucks moving bumper to bumber.
